On June 15th, three armored car employees were shot and killed and another was critically injured in a post-midnight attack at the University of Alberta's mall and residence complex. Suspect and fellow armored car guard Travis Baumgartner's mother issued a statement pleading for the 21-year-old to turn himself in. Police spokesman Bob Hassel read from Sandy Baumgartner's emotional statement at a news conference in Edmonton. (Baumgartner was arrested the next day at the Lynden, Washington border crossing near Abbotsford, BC with more than 330-thousand dollars stashed in his truck. He was formally charged with three counts of first-degree murder, one count of attempted murder and four counts of robbery with a firearm. A trial was slated for September, 2013.)
